As Corinthia Rome prepares to open its doors, we are crafting a team that embodies our philosophy of excellence, grace, and genuine care. Every Corinthia hotel is defined by its people — professionals who bring warmth, precision, and passion to their craft.

We are now seeking an Accounts Receivable professional to join our Finance team.

This role is key to ensuring the accuracy and integrity of our financial transactions, maintaining smooth payment processes, and supporting our commitment to outstanding guest and partner relationships.

Key responsibilities include:
  • Reviewing guest ledger, city ledger, and advance deposits in accordance with procedures
  • Ensuring that all hotel revenues settled by city ledger are accurately recorded and properly supported
  • Controlling and balancing all advance deposits
  • Calculating and processing travel agent commissions and ensuring proper authorization
  • Following up on overdue accounts and assisting with collections and resolutions
  • Reconciling receivables accounts, credit card payments, chargebacks, deposits, and commissions
  • Processing refunds for overpayments or cancelled reservations
  • Managing month‑end processes, accruals, and journals
  • Assisting in the preparation of monthly financial statements and balance sheet reconciliations
  • Ensuring compliance with financial policies and procedures
  • Supporting external audits with complete documentation and clear communication
  • Collaborating closely with colleagues across Finance and other departments to maintain seamless operations
Who We’re Looking For:
  • Minimum 2 years of experience in a similar role, ideally within luxury hospitality
  • Proven expertise in hotel accounting and operational systems
  • Fluency in English and Italian (written and spoken)
  • Excellent analytical, organizational, and interpersonal skills
  • High discretion and attention to detail in managing sensitive financial data
  • Degree in Economics or a related field
  • Proficiency in Sun System, Opera Cloud, Simphony, Book4Time, and Adaco is a plus
  • Strong Microsoft Office skills, particularly Excel
  • A proactive, collaborative, and detail‑oriented mindset
  • Legal right to work in Italy
